Lynn Johnston
Johnston reframes the landscape of comic strips by focusing on the intricacies of family life and the passage of time. Her work, particularly in the iconic comic strip "For Better or For Worse", reflects on the authentic portrayal of family dynamics through the natural aging of characters and the inclusion of real-life issues such as relationships, illness, and loss. Influenced by esteemed cartoonists like Charles M. Schulz and Bill Watterson, Johnston's storytelling is distinguished by its emotional depth and warmth, inviting readers to connect deeply with the characters' experiences.\n\nBeyond her thematic contributions, Johnston employs a narrative technique that mirrors the everyday lives of her audience. Her early work as a medical artist at McMaster University and her initial book, "David, We're Pregnant!", showcase her unique ability to blend humor with realism, setting a precedent for her later successes. Readers of her comics benefit from an honest reflection of life's challenges and joys, allowing them to see their own stories within the pages. Johnston's achievements extend to being the first woman to win the prestigious Reuben Award for Outstanding Cartoonist of the Year, a testament to her impact in the field.\n\nLynn Johnston's influence reaches beyond her comic strip; her books and recognition in the cartooning world underline her significant role as an author and creator. With her work appearing in over 2,000 newspapers globally and reaching millions, her bio is a testament to her pioneering spirit in the arts. Her appointment as a Member of the Order of Canada further cements her legacy, underscoring the cultural impact of her narratives that continue to resonate with audiences worldwide.
